How to Find the Right Travel Agent for You

Finding the right travel agent is like finding a travel buddy – you need someone who understands your needs and preferences. Here’s a step-by-step guide:

1. Identify Your Travel Style and Needs:

Are you a luxury traveler seeking bespoke experiences, or a budget-conscious adventurer? Do you prefer guided tours or independent exploration? Defining your travel style and priorities will help you narrow down your search.

2. Seek Recommendations and Read Reviews:

3. Look for Specialization and Expertise:

Some agents specialize in specific destinations, types of travel (adventure, luxury, family), or interests (culinary, history, wildlife). Choosing an agent with expertise in your desired travel style or destination can enhance your experience.

4. Schedule a Consultation:

Most travel agents offer free consultations. Use this opportunity to discuss your travel vision, budget, and expectations. Pay attention to their communication style, responsiveness, and willingness to answer your questions.

5. Check Credentials and Affiliations:

Look for agents who are members of reputable travel organizations, such as the American Society of Travel Advisors (ASTA) or the International Air Transport Association (IATA). These affiliations indicate professionalism and adherence to industry standards.

Questions to Ask a Potential Travel Agent

Don’t be afraid to ask questions! Here’s a cheat sheet:

  • What type of travel do you specialize in?
  • Do you have experience with [your desired destination]?
  • How do you find the best deals and discounts?
  • What is your fee structure?
  • What kind of support do you offer during my trip?
  • Can you provide references from past clients?
